HomePhabricator

[backport#15932] rpc: Add lock annotations to block{,header}ToJSON

Description

[backport#15932] rpc: Add lock annotations to block{,header}ToJSON

Summary:
https://github.com/bitcoin/bitcoin/pull/15932/commits/faea56400d5578023133cf4d1c761cdeb0c3e3da


Depends on D6297

Concludes backport of Core PR15932

Test Plan:

cmake .. -GNinja -DENABLE_SANITIZERS=thread
ninja check

Reviewers: #bitcoin_abc, nakihito

Reviewed By: nakihito

Differential Revision: https://reviews.bitcoinabc.org/D6300

Details

Provenance
MarcoFalke <falke.marco@gmail.com>Authored on May 2 2019, 18:34
majcostaCommitted on Jun 1 2020, 12:55
majcostaPushed on Jun 1 2020, 12:56
Reviewer
nakihito
Differential Revision
D6300: [backport#15932] rpc: Add lock annotations to block{,header}ToJSON
Parents
rABC6cd4a39874a9: [backport#15932] rpc: Serialize in getblock without cs_main
Branches
Unknown
Tags
Unknown